- race game (board game played with dice in which the object is to reach the end of a track)
- ban-sugoroku; sugoroku; traditional Japanese board game similar to backgammon
This meaning refers to a type of board game that involves rolling dice to advance along a predetermined track, with the aim of being the first to reach the finish line. Such games are popular for social gatherings and family activities.
We are enjoying a game where we roll the dice and advance toward the goal.
This meaning points to a traditional Japanese board game that has some structural similarities to backgammon, involving pieces movement around the board based on dice rolls. It is typically played with two players.
